The Basics of Recycled Glass Mosaic Tiles
Recycled glass mosaic tiles are made from processed glass waste that is transformed into beautiful and durable tiles. These tiles are not only eco-friendly but also boast vibrant colors and unique textures, making them an attractive choice for various applications. Their ability to reflect light adds depth and dimension to surfaces, enhancing both aesthetic appeal and functionality.
Characteristics of Recycled Glass Mosaic Tiles
One of the most significant advantages of recycled glass mosaic tiles is their sustainability. By reusing glass materials, these tiles help reduce landfill waste and conserve natural resources. Additionally, they are non-porous, which means they resist stains and are easy to clean—ideal for areas like kitchens and bathrooms. The variety in colors and patterns allows for creative expression, making them suitable for backsplashes, accent walls, or even artistic installations.
Application Areas for Recycled Glass Mosaic Tiles
The versatility of recycled glass mosaic tiles extends to numerous applications. They can be used in residential and commercial spaces, enhancing the look of floors, walls, and countertops. From modern kitchens to trendy restaurants, these tiles create a unique atmosphere. Their reflective qualities can also make small spaces appear larger and brighter, making them a prime choice for compact areas.
Exploring Natural Stone Mosaic Tiles
Natural stone mosaic tiles, on the other hand, are crafted from various types of stone—such as marble, granite, and slate. These tiles bring an organic and timeless beauty to any project. The unique veining and textures found in natural stone provide a sense of authenticity and luxury that is hard to replicate.

Characteristics of Natural Stone Mosaic Tiles
Durability is a standout feature of natural stone mosaic tiles. They are highly resistant to wear and tear, making them suitable for high-traffic areas. Their natural composition means they exist in a wide variety of colors and patterns, conveying a sense of elegance and sophistication. Unlike synthetic materials, stone tiles age gracefully, often enhancing their appeal over time.
Application Areas for Natural Stone Mosaic Tiles
Ideal for both indoor and outdoor applications, natural stone mosaic tiles fit seamlessly into any design scheme. They're often used for flooring, shower walls, and fireplace surrounds, offering versatility for space usage. Homeowners and designers appreciate these tiles for their ability to instill a sense of warmth and earthiness, making them a fantastic choice for rustic or traditional settings.
Recycled Glass Mosaic Tile vs Natural Stone Mosaic Tile: Making the Decision
When comparing recycled glass mosaic tiles vs natural stone mosaic tiles, the choice ultimately depends on your project needs and aesthetic preferences. Recycled glass tiles excel in sustainability and a colorful, modern design, while natural stone tiles offer durability and a classic, elegant look.
Consider your functional requirements. If you seek easy maintenance and eco-friendliness, recycled glass mosaic tiles are your best bet. For a more timeless appeal that stands the test of time, natural stone mosaic tiles might be the right choice for you.
